Transaction

a634e963daedab77d8a8d0e4d87633cc417081989b9ff7687f4906eee77f32fa
53,335 confirmations
Timestamp
1740161928
Block884,743
Fee660 sats
Fee rate6 sats/vB
view on mempool.space

Inputs & Outputs